Italy is a country known for its rich cultural heritage and stunning landscapes. It is also a popular destination for students looking to further their education in the field of landscape architecture. Master's degree programs in landscape architecture in Italy offer students the opportunity to study in a unique and inspiring environment while gaining a comprehensive understanding of the field.

Where to study
One of the top universities in Italy for landscape architecture is the Politecnico di Milano. The university offers a Master of Science in Landscape Architecture, which is a two-year program that covers a wide range of topics, including landscape design, history, ecology, and sustainability. The program is taught in English and is designed for students from all over the world. The curriculum includes both theoretical and practical components, with a strong focus on design and hands-on projects.
Another great option for students interested in landscape architecture is the University of Florence. The university offers a Master of Science in Landscape Architecture and Planning, which is a two-year program that covers a wide range of topics, including landscape design, ecology, urban planning, and sustainability. The program is taught in English and is designed for students from all over the world. The curriculum includes both theoretical and practical components, with a strong focus on design and hands-on projects.
